JACKSON, Wyo. — It’s cattle drive season in Jackson Hole.

Mead Ranch will be moving its cattle down Spring Gulch Road on Sunday, Sept. 17. Drivers should expect delays or avoid the area from 8 a.m. to about 12 p.m.

Use caution and remember, cows have less traction on roads. The University of Wyoming recommends keeping speeds under 10 mph when encountering a cattle drive.
